Description

A CountryPrints production sample retained as a print record. A six-screen/seven-color silkscreen print on white linen depicting a woven wallhanging typical of early eighteenth century Norwegian woven carpets with colorful people and plant life against an orange ground. In the lower margin is the source, signature and title, “COMPOSITE NORWEGIAN RUG DESIGNS — EARLY 18 CENTURY, r. darr wert by hand” and “NORSK II”. The print is glued to a black wood hanging bar at top and bottom, and a cord is attached for hanging. Edges are fringed.
